return "Student: " + super.toString(); } } 接下来,我们可以创建一个Employee类,继承自Person类,并添加办公室、工资和受聘日期的属性,并使用MyDate类处理日期数据。同样,需要添加相应的构造方法和toString方法。 java Copy Code public class Employee extends Person { private String office; private double sala...
【程序题】设计一个名为 Person 的类,它的两个派生类为Student 和Employee ,以及Employee 的两个派生类Faculty 和Staff 。 ( 1 )一个人(Person )有一个名字、一个地址、一个电话号码和一个E-mail 地址。在Person 类中定义一个常量虚函数toString ,并在每个类中覆盖toString 函数,用来输出类名和人名。 ( 2...
}classStudent:privatePerson{private:intclass_no;intscore;public:voidInit_Student(char*str2,intage2,chars2,intc_no,intscore1);voidshow_st(); };voidStudent::Init_Student(char*str2,intage2,chars2,intc_no,intscore1){ Init_Person(str2,age2,s2); class_no=c_no; score=score1; }voidStudent...
Person student = new Student("XIXI", "baidu", 123456, "xixi@gmail.com", Student.FRESHER);System.out.println(student);Employee employee = new Employee("Cici", "google", 123456, "cici@gmail.com", "A5", 2000.0);System.out.println(employee);System.out.println("---");Faculty...
实现一个名为Person的类和它的子类Student和Employee。Employee有子类Faculty和Staff。Person中的人有姓名、地址和电话号码。Employee中雇员有办公室、工资。Student中的学生有班级状态(一、二、三、四年级)。Faculty中的教员有级别。Staff中的职员有职务称号。覆盖每个类中的toString方法,显示类名和人名。?创建测试类用于...